A while back i contacted our own Hamish looking for a recommendation regarding a not too expensive but good small digital camera for the guy i look after, so his staff can take good photos on his days out.
Hamish recommended the Fuji 'Z300', i listern to Hamish cos he has a passion for Photography..we found one at an amazingly cheap price. Through the postie it came & wow what a loverly little thing, all metal with massive touch screen. Since then i, myself has purchased one i was that impressed.
Thanks very much to Hamish from both of us for the heads up, the single most usefull recommendation anyones ever given me.

The thing with the z300 is that it was originally a £200 camera ... Fuji great for drastically reducing the cost of there cameras toward the end of thier run ... January - march time is always a good time to pick up a Fuji bargain ...
